Bezirtzoglou, Christos was born on November 12, 1966 in Athens, Greece. Son of Venizelos-Eleutherios C. and Elissabet (Rafailidou) Bezirtzoglou.

Bachelor of Science in Physics, U. Patras, Greece, 1991; postgraduate, Open U., United Kingdom, since 1996; postgraduate, Institute Information Strategy Development, Greece, 1993; PGC in Applied Software Engineering, Hellenic Management Association, Greece, 1994; diploma analysis & design information system, Athens Economics U., Greece, 1993; diploma design/management computer networks, National Technology U. Athens, 1993.
Freelance analyst, programmer, Greece, 1989-1992; trainer, Hellenic Management Association, Athens, 1993-1994; consultant, Alexander Young Horwath, Piraeus, Greece, 1994-1995; 2d line support manager, European Union, Brussels, 1995-1998; assistant to director Directorate General IV.C, European Union, Brussels, since 1999. Organizing committee microbial ecology and disease International Congress, 1990, organizing committee anaerobic bacteria and anaerobic infections International Congress, 1996. Committee member Standarison Body, since 1989.
Served with Greek military, 1992-1993. Member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ers (Studies. committee since 1988), Association Computing Machinery, Greek Computer Society, Hellenic Physics Association, Greek-French Science Society, The Brain Club, Mensa.
Married Anna I.Katrami, January 3, 1997.
